当前位置: 首页 > news >正文

网站建设包括啥深圳网站建设的公司招聘

网站建设包括啥,深圳网站建设的公司招聘,网站怎么做效果好,东莞网站公司哪家好大纲 新建工程新增依赖 编码自动产生数据写入RabbitMQ 测试工程代码 在 《Java版Flink使用指南——从RabbitMQ中队列中接入消息流》一文中,我们介绍了如何使用Java在Flink中读取RabbitMQ中的数据,并将其写入日志中。本文将通过代码产生一些数据&#xf…

大纲

  • 新建工程
    • 新增依赖
  • 编码
    • 自动产生数据
    • 写入RabbitMQ
  • 测试
  • 工程代码

在 《Java版Flink使用指南——从RabbitMQ中队列中接入消息流》一文中,我们介绍了如何使用Java在Flink中读取RabbitMQ中的数据,并将其写入日志中。本文将通过代码产生一些数据,然后将它们写入到另外一个RabbitMQ队列中。

新建工程

我们在IntelliJ中新建一个工程SinkToRabbitMQ。
Archetype填入:org.apache.flink:flink-quickstart-java
版本填入与Flink的版本:1.19.1
在这里插入图片描述

新增依赖

在pom.xml中新增RabbitMQ连接器

		<dependency><groupId>org.apache.flink</groupId><artifactId>flink-connector-rabbitmq</artifactId><version>3.0.1-1.17</version></dependency>

编码

自动产生数据

这段代码将产生两个字符串数据,后续这些数据会被写入到RabbitMQ的队列中。

List<String> data = new ArrayList<>();
data.add("Hello, World!");
data.add("Hello, Flink!");
DataStream<String> stream = env.fromCollection(data);

写入RabbitMQ

不同于《Java版Flink使用指南——从RabbitMQ中队列中接入消息流》中创建RMQSource用来接收RabbitMQ队列中数据,这次我们创建RMQSink用来发布数据。

String sinkQueueName = "data.to.rbtmq"; // name of the queue to send data to
String host = "172.21.112.140"; // IP of the rabbitmq server
int port = 5672;
String username = "admin";
String password = "fangliang";
String virtualHost = "/";
int parallelism = 1;RMQConnectionConfig rmqConnectionConfig = new RMQConnectionConfig.Builder().setHost(host).setPort(port).setUserName(username).setPassword(password).setVirtualHost(virtualHost).build();RMQSink<String> stringRMQSink = new RMQSink<>(rmqConnectionConfig, sinkQueueName, new SimpleStringSchema());
stream.addSink(stringRMQSink).name(username + "'s sink to " + sinkQueueName).setParallelism(parallelism);	

测试

打包、提交并运行任务
在这里插入图片描述
然后在RabbitMQ的后台可以看到收到两条消息
在这里插入图片描述
其内容也是我们之前在代码中生成的内容
在这里插入图片描述

工程代码

https://github.com/f304646673/FlinkDemo

http://www.yayakq.cn/news/56223/

相关文章:

  • 网站大气是什么意思wordpress 文章图集
  • 禅城区网站建设公司seo与网站建设
  • 舆情网站直接打开怎么弄苏州制作网站的公司简介
  • 国外自适应网站模版职业培训热门行业
  • 明会红网站怎么创办一个网站
  • 常熟住房和城乡建设局网站首页找装修公司电话
  • 麻阳住房和城乡建设局网站网站维护常见问题
  • 有人利用婚恋网站做微商wordpress4.6 手册
  • 易云巢做网站公司深圳建设局网站首页
  • 开发网站用什么软件怎么做app和网站购物
  • wordpress 统计绍兴关键词优化报价
  • cms中文版网站模板做网站是不是就能上传东西
  • 团购网站怎么做中企动力网站推广
  • 如何让搜索引擎快速收录网站网站推广的基本手段
  • 做网站和app多少费用网络公司有什么职位
  • 怎么在百度做原创视频网站收录优美图片官网
  • 网站建设实训的目的做的网站访问不了
  • 如何给网站设置关键词有没有免费看的视频
  • 金山网站建设关键词排名怎么注册公司微信
  • 营销型网站应用建网站在线支付怎么
  • 网站在百度搜索不到做网站发广告
  • 设计建筑的软件铁岭网站建设网络优化
  • seo百度站长工具查询广州科技有限公司
  • 怎么用表格做网站wordpress 数据导出
  • 江苏省内网站建设好网站范例
  • 高台网站建设成都网络推广服务
  • 自助建站信息发布网企业徐州优化网站
  • 网站开发工程师职责基于wordpress的网站
  • 乐都企业网站建设多少钱济宁建筑人才网
  • 网站新备案不能访问网站手机版建设